HER2 mutant non-small cell lung cancer is a rare form of lung cancer where a specific change occurs in a protein called HER2, affecting how cells grow and behave. This type accounts for around 2 to 4 percent of all non-small cell lung cancer cases and tends to affect younger people, women, and those who have never smoked or smoked lightly.
Understanding What This Diagnosis Means for Your Future
When you or someone you love receives a diagnosis of HER2 mutant non-small cell lung cancer, one of the first questions that comes to mind is often about prognosis. It’s completely natural to want to know what lies ahead. Prognosis refers to the likely course and outcome of the disease, including how long someone might live and how well treatments might work.
People with HER2 mutations in their lung cancer have historically faced some unique challenges. Research has shown that patients with this particular mutation sometimes experience a more difficult course compared to those with other types of lung cancer.[14] This includes a higher likelihood of the cancer spreading to the brain, which can complicate treatment planning and affect quality of life.[13]
For patients with advanced, or stage IV, disease, studies have shown varying survival times. In one real-world study of 23 patients with stage IV HER2 mutant lung cancer, the median overall survival was approximately 10.7 months, with about 27 percent of patients surviving two years.[14] However, it’s crucial to understand that these numbers represent older data, from before newer targeted therapies became available. The landscape has changed significantly in recent years.
In a different study examining treatment outcomes, patients who received standard chemotherapy experienced progression-free survival of about 6.7 months with their first treatment.[11] This means the disease remained controlled, without growing or spreading, for this period of time. When these same patients needed a second treatment, the disease control lasted a median of 4.9 months.[11]
The outlook for patients with earlier stages of HER2 mutant lung cancer appears more encouraging. In one study, all patients diagnosed with stage I through stage III disease were still alive at the two-year mark, suggesting that when caught earlier, this cancer may be more manageable.[14]
An important development in recent years is the approval of new targeted therapies specifically designed for HER2 mutations. These medications work differently than traditional chemotherapy and may offer improved outcomes. For instance, in a clinical trial called DESTINY-Lung02, tumors shrank in 58 percent of patients who received a targeted therapy called trastuzumab deruxtecan, and among those who responded, the treatment kept the cancer under control for a median of 9 months.[7] This represents a meaningful improvement over historical data and brings new hope to patients facing this diagnosis.
How the Disease Develops Without Treatment
Understanding the natural progression of HER2 mutant non-small cell lung cancer helps explain why timely diagnosis and treatment are so important. When left untreated, this type of cancer follows a path that can cause increasing health problems over time.
The HER2 protein normally sits on the surface of cells and helps regulate cell growth. When a mutation occurs in the HER2 gene, it causes abnormal changes at the base of the HER2 protein inside the cell.[3] This mutation makes the protein become activated all the time, like a switch that’s permanently turned on. This constant activation promotes the uncontrolled growth of cancer cells, allowing them to multiply and spread in ways they normally wouldn’t.
As the disease progresses without intervention, the cancer cells continue to multiply within the lungs. This growth can cause a variety of symptoms that gradually worsen. Patients may develop a persistent cough that doesn’t go away, experience pressure or pain in the chest, and feel increasingly fatigued as the cancer demands more of the body’s resources.[10] Some people also experience unexplained weight loss as the disease advances.
One particularly concerning aspect of untreated HER2 mutant lung cancer is its tendency to spread, or metastasize, to other parts of the body. Metastasis occurs when cancer cells break away from the original tumor and travel through the bloodstream or lymphatic system to establish new tumors in distant organs. In HER2 mutant lung cancer, the brain is a common site for metastasis, and research indicates that patients with this mutation face a higher risk of brain metastases compared to some other types of lung cancer.[13]
Fluid can also accumulate around the lungs in a condition called pleural effusion. This happens when cancer cells irritate the lining of the lungs, causing fluid to build up in the space between the lung and chest wall. In one patient’s story, 3 liters of fluid had collected in the left lung, causing it to completely collapse.[10] This fluid accumulation makes breathing extremely difficult and requires medical intervention to drain it.
As the cancer continues its natural course, it can spread to the liver, bones, and other vital organs. The establishment of tumors in multiple locations throughout the body defines stage IV, or metastatic, disease. At this advanced stage, symptoms multiply as different organ systems become affected, and the body’s ability to function normally becomes increasingly compromised.
Possible Complications That May Arise
Even with treatment, HER2 mutant non-small cell lung cancer can lead to various complications that affect health and wellbeing. Being aware of these possibilities helps patients and families recognize warning signs and seek prompt medical attention when needed.
Brain metastases represent one of the most significant complications associated with HER2 mutant lung cancer. When cancer spreads to the brain, it can cause headaches, seizures, balance problems, changes in vision, weakness in parts of the body, or alterations in personality and thinking.[13] The higher incidence of brain metastases in HER2 mutant patients compared to other lung cancer subtypes makes regular monitoring of the brain particularly important.
Respiratory complications are common as the disease affects lung function. Beyond the breathlessness caused by tumor growth and fluid accumulation, patients may develop pneumonia or other lung infections. The lungs’ reduced capacity can make even simple activities like walking across a room or climbing stairs exhausting. Some patients require supplemental oxygen to maintain adequate oxygen levels in their blood.
Treatment itself can bring complications. Chemotherapy, while often necessary, can lower white blood cell counts, a condition called neutropenia. This leaves the body vulnerable to infections because white blood cells are crucial soldiers in the immune system’s fight against germs.[3] Patients must watch carefully for signs of infection, such as fever or chills, and report them immediately to their healthcare team.
Some targeted therapies, particularly antibody-drug conjugates like trastuzumab deruxtecan, can cause serious lung problems separate from the cancer itself. These lung complications can be severe and even life-threatening.[3] Symptoms include new or worsening cough, trouble breathing, shortness of breath, fever, and chest tightness or wheezing. Healthcare providers monitor patients closely for these symptoms and may treat them with corticosteroid medicines if they develop.
Heart problems can emerge as another complication, particularly with certain HER2-targeted therapies. The heart’s ability to pump blood effectively may become impaired, leading to symptoms like swelling of the ankles or legs, irregular heartbeat, sudden weight gain, dizziness, and feeling lightheaded.[3] Regular heart function monitoring is essential during treatment.
Pain is a complication that affects many patients as the disease progresses. Cancer spreading to bones causes bone pain, while tumors pressing on nerves can create different types of pain. Metastases to the liver or other organs can cause discomfort in those areas. Managing pain effectively requires a comprehensive approach and open communication with the healthcare team about what you’re experiencing.
Nutritional complications often develop as the disease advances. Weight loss may occur not only because cancer cells consume energy but also because treatments can cause nausea, changes in taste, and loss of appetite. Difficulty swallowing can develop if tumors or lymph nodes press on the esophagus. Maintaining adequate nutrition becomes increasingly challenging yet remains important for maintaining strength and tolerating treatment.
Impact on Daily Life and Living with the Disease
A diagnosis of HER2 mutant non-small cell lung cancer affects far more than just physical health. It touches every aspect of daily life, from the most routine tasks to long-term plans and relationships. Understanding these impacts can help patients and families prepare for the journey ahead and find ways to maintain quality of life.
Physical limitations often become one of the first noticeable changes. Simple activities that once required no thought—climbing stairs, carrying groceries, playing with children or grandchildren—may become difficult or impossible depending on the day and the progression of the disease. Breathlessness is particularly limiting. One patient described still being able to hike 4 to 5 miles a day initially, even with chest pressure, but needing to go to urgent care when symptoms worsened.[10] As treatment progresses, fatigue often becomes a constant companion, making it necessary to rest frequently and prioritize activities.
Work life typically requires significant adjustments. Many patients need to reduce their hours, take extended leave, or stop working entirely, at least temporarily. For younger patients, this diagnosis can feel particularly disruptive, as one 37-year-old patient discovered when facing lung cancer despite no smoking history.[10] The interruption to career trajectory, loss of professional identity, and financial concerns add stress to an already overwhelming situation.
Emotional and mental health impacts are profound and should never be underestimated. Receiving a cancer diagnosis, especially a rare mutation that many people haven’t heard of, can feel isolating. Fear, anxiety, and uncertainty about the future are completely normal responses. Some patients describe the diagnosis as “mind-numbing,” particularly when it seems to come out of nowhere.[10] Depression can develop as patients grapple with their mortality, changes in their body, and disruption of their life plans.
Social life and relationships undergo transformation. While some friendships deepen through shared vulnerability, others may fade as people struggle to know what to say or how to help. Patients often find themselves in the uncomfortable position of managing other people’s emotions about their diagnosis. Social activities may become limited by physical symptoms, treatment schedules, or the need to avoid crowds during periods of low immunity.
Family dynamics shift significantly. Partners often transition into caregiver roles, which can strain even the strongest relationships. One patient mentioned her husband as her “absolute world and soulmate,” highlighting how critical partner support becomes during this journey.[10] Plans for the future—vacations, retirement dreams, watching children or grandchildren grow—must be reconsidered and sometimes put on hold or adapted.
The practical challenges of managing the disease add another layer of complexity to daily life. Keeping track of multiple medications, attending frequent medical appointments, coordinating with various specialists, managing side effects, and navigating insurance coverage become almost like a part-time job. The healthcare system itself can feel overwhelming, particularly when dealing with a rare mutation where treatment options are still being researched.
Financial stress affects most patients to some degree. Even with insurance, the costs of cancer treatment can be substantial. Lost income from being unable to work compounds the problem. Families may need to make difficult decisions about spending, savings, and priorities. The financial toxicity of cancer treatment is a real phenomenon that deserves acknowledgment and support.
Despite these challenges, many patients find ways to adapt and maintain meaningful lives. Some develop new hobbies that accommodate their physical limitations. Others find purpose in advocacy, connecting with other patients, or participating in research. Many patients report that cancer, while devastating, has taught them to appreciate simple moments, prioritize what truly matters, and strengthen important relationships.
Maintaining hope while being realistic about challenges represents a delicate balance. Connecting with others facing similar diagnoses can help, whether through support groups, online communities, or patient advocacy organizations. Learning about the latest research and treatment options, including clinical trials, can provide a sense of agency and possibility during uncertain times.
Support for Families and Clinical Trial Participation
Families play an invaluable role in supporting someone with HER2 mutant non-small cell lung cancer. Beyond providing emotional comfort and practical help, family members can be instrumental in helping patients access potentially beneficial clinical trials. Understanding what clinical trials are and how families can assist opens additional pathways for treatment and hope.
Clinical trials are research studies that test new approaches to treatment, including experimental drugs, new combinations of existing therapies, or innovative ways of delivering treatment. For rare mutations like HER2 in lung cancer, clinical trials are particularly important because they provide access to cutting-edge therapies that aren’t yet widely available. In fact, many of the treatments now considered standard for HER2 mutant lung cancer came through clinical trial participation.
The landscape of HER2 targeted therapy has evolved rapidly through clinical trial research. There has been an influx of research on antibody-drug conjugates, monoclonal antibodies, and tyrosine kinase inhibitors.[2] New drugs like zongertinib and sevabertinib are showing promising activity in ongoing trials for HER2 mutant NSCLC.[12] Without patients willing to participate in clinical trials, these advances would not be possible.
Families can help by first understanding that clinical trials are not “last resort” options but often represent access to the most innovative treatments available. Many families worry that participation means their loved one will receive inferior care or a placebo instead of treatment. However, in cancer trials, particularly for a disease with limited options like HER2 mutant lung cancer, participants typically receive either the current standard treatment or the new therapy being tested—not a placebo alone.
One practical way families can support clinical trial participation is by helping research and identify appropriate trials. This involves searching clinical trial databases, reaching out to major cancer centers that specialize in lung cancer, and asking the healthcare team about available studies. Families can compile information about different trials, including their locations, eligibility requirements, and what they’re testing, to help the patient make informed decisions without feeling overwhelmed.
Understanding eligibility criteria is crucial. Clinical trials have specific requirements about who can participate, including things like the stage of disease, prior treatments received, overall health status, and the presence of specific mutations. For HER2 mutant lung cancer, confirming the exact type of HER2 alteration is essential, as some trials target specific mutations while others focus on HER2 overexpression or amplification.[2] Families can help gather medical records and ensure all necessary testing has been completed to determine eligibility.
The logistical support families provide can make clinical trial participation feasible. Trials often require frequent visits to specialized centers, which may be far from home. Families can help arrange transportation, accompany the patient to appointments, take notes during complex medical discussions, and help track side effects or changes in symptoms. This practical support allows patients to focus on their treatment rather than drowning in logistics.
Emotional support during clinical trial participation is equally important. Patients may feel anxious about being part of research, uncertain about whether they’re making the right choice, or worried about experiencing unknown side effects. Family members can provide reassurance, help patients recognize positive signs, and offer perspective during difficult moments. Celebrating small victories—a scan showing tumor shrinkage, completing another cycle of treatment—matters deeply.
Families should also prepare for the possibility that a clinical trial might not work as hoped or that their loved one may not be eligible for certain trials. Having open, honest conversations with the healthcare team about backup plans and alternative options helps everyone feel more prepared. Understanding that clinical trials are voluntary and that patients can withdraw at any time if they choose provides important peace of mind.
Financial considerations related to clinical trial participation deserve family discussion. While the experimental treatment itself is typically provided free of charge, there may be costs associated with travel, lodging near the trial site, time away from work for both patient and caregivers, and routine care costs that insurance would normally cover. Some trials offer stipends or assistance with these expenses, and families can inquire about available support programs.
